Valued at $7.0B following a 9% year-over-year increase, the Patriots represent one of the NFL's most operationally efficient franchises, generating $235M in operating income on $800M in revenue—a 29% margin that reflects both the strength of the New England market and disciplined cost management under long-tenured owner Robert Kraft since 1994. The franchise's value appreciation has been driven primarily by NFL media rights escalation and Gillette Stadium's premium positioning, though the post-Brady era transition (2020 onward) has introduced competitive uncertainty that warrants monitoring against league-wide talent cost inflation. Key investment considerations include the aging stadium infrastructure relative to newer NFL facilities, the Patriots' below-average on-field performance in recent seasons, and upcoming quarterback monetization opportunity if the team develops a marketable talent pipeline comparable to the Brady era.
